Background
Environmental enteric dysfunction (EED), a condition characterized by small intestine inflammation and abnormal gut permeability, is widespread in children in developing countries and a major cause of growth failure. The pathophysiology of EED remains poorly understood.
Methods
We measured serum metabolites using li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ry in 400 children, aged 12–59months, from rural Malawi. Gut permeability was assessed by the dual-sugar absorption test.
Findings
80.7% of children had EED. Of 677 serum metabolites measured, 21 were negatively associated and 56 were positively associated with gut permeability, using a false discovery rate approach (q<0.05, p<0.0095).
